DURANT, Okla. – State Representative John Carey will be the speaker at Southeastern Oklahoma State University's Fall Commencement.
The event is scheduled for Saturday, Dec. 12, in the new Bloomer Sullivan Arena. The ceremony begins at 10 a.m. and will be followed immediately by a reception for the graduates and their friends and families in the Visual and Performing Arts Center.
"We are honored that Representative Carey has accepted our invitation to be the speaker at the December commencement," said Southeastern interim president Larry Minks. "He has proven to be a staunch supporter of higher education and Southeastern Oklahoma State University. He is an outstanding role model for our students, and we take great pride in the fact that he is a Southeastern graduate."
Representing District 21, Carey earned a bachelor's degree in banking/finance at Southeastern in 1992. His committee assignments include Appropriation and Budget, Economic Development, and Veterans and Military Affairs (Vice Chair).
The Durant native has been active in civic affairs, serving as a Gear-Up mentor, a Crisis Control board member, a board member of the Oklahoma State University Consumer & Family Services Advisory Committee, past chairman of the Bryan County Junior Livestock Show, and as a member of the Southeastern Oklahoma State University Homecoming Committee.
Carey and his wife Pam, have three children, Guy Walter (G.W.), Anna Scott, and Emma Claire.
